Belgian retailer Delhaize has said it has acquired 43 Harveys supermarkets in Georgia and Florida for US$26.1m in cash.


“The acquisition fills in an area where Food Lion, the largest US banner of Delhaize Group, has a limited presence,” Delhaize said. 


Delhaize, which does most of its business in the US, said it would also assume around $18m in accounts payable and other short-term liabilities associated with the operation of Harveys.


The acquisition includes Harveys corporate headquarters and warehouses in Nashville, Georgia.


The company said Harveys would continue to operate as a separate entity, but would receive “strategic support and assistance” from Food Lion.
